Technical Field
The invention relates to the field of medical care, in particular to a novel nursing bed.
Background
Currently, in the medical care industry, patients with damaged waist, damaged legs and damaged shoulders and mobility impaired people often need to lie on a nursing bed for nursing, and long-time lying is easy to cause numbness of body muscles, the body position needs to be changed from time to time, and sometimes the patient needs to be changed into the body position.
The prior nursing bed is provided with a plurality of rocking bars, the rocking bars drive the screw rod to realize the actions of different positions, such as the lifting of the foot position, the lifting of the waist position, the lifting of the neck position and the lifting of the whole bed frame, so as to achieve the needs of patients or facilitate nursing. In the prior art, one rocker can only realize the change of one action, and sometimes different rockers need to be rocked when a plurality of body positions change, so that the change of the body positions is realized, and certain inconvenience is caused for nursing.
Based on this, how to achieve a simplified way of adjusting the nursing bed is a technical problem that the person skilled in the art is currently required to solve.

As shown in fig. 1, 2 and 3, a novel nursing bed as a preferred embodiment of the present invention comprises a bed frame 1, a lower frame 13, a lifting mechanism, a back lifting mechanism 2, a leg bending and foot lifting mechanism 4, a push rod and a crank 8 fixed below the bed frame 1, wherein the bed frame 1 is connected with the lower frame 13 through the lifting mechanism, a clutch device 7 is installed on the medical bed, the clutch device 7 is fixedly installed below the bed tail of the bed frame 1, and one end of an input shaft 24 of the clutch device 7 is connected with the crank 8.
The lifting mechanism is respectively rotationally assembled on a first rotating shaft 10 and a second rotating shaft 15, the first rotating shaft 10 is positioned below the bed head of the bed frame 1, the second rotating shaft 15 is positioned below the bed tail of the bed frame 1, the first rotating shaft 10 is connected with the first push rod 3 through a first bracket 9, one end of the first bracket 9 is fixed on the first rotating shaft 10, the other end of the first bracket is hinged with one end of the first push rod 3, and the other end of the first push rod 3 is connected with the shaft of the clutch device 7.
The second rotating shaft 15 is connected with the second push rod 6 through the second bracket 14, one end of the second bracket 14 is fixed on the second rotating shaft 15, the other end is hinged with one end of the second push rod 6, and the other end of the second push rod 6 is connected with a shaft on the clutch device 7.
Preferably, the other end of the first push rod 3 is connected with the input shaft 24, when the other end of the second push rod 6 is connected with the output shaft 17, the clutch device 7 controls the input shaft 24 to rotate in a single shaft, the crank 8 is rotated to drive the input shaft 24 to rotate, the first push rod 3 acts, the second push rod 6 is not moved, the bed frame 1 rotates around the second rotating shaft 15, and the bed head of the bed frame 1 is lifted or lowered; when the input shaft 24 and the output shaft 17 are linked, the first push rod 3 and the second push rod 6 simultaneously operate, and the entire bed frame 1 is raised or lowered.
Preferably, the other end of the first push rod 3 is connected with the output shaft 17, the other end of the second push rod 6 is connected with the input shaft 24, when the clutch device 7 controls the input shaft 24 to rotate in a single shaft, the crank 8 is rotated to drive the input shaft 24 to rotate, the second push rod 6 acts, the first push rod 3 is not moved, the bedstead 1 can rotate around the first rotating shaft 10, and the tailstock of the bedstead 1 can be lifted or lowered; when the input shaft 24 and the output shaft 17 are linked, the first push rod 3 and the second push rod 6 simultaneously operate, and the entire bed frame 1 is raised or lowered.
The connection mode of the first push rod 3, the second push rod 6 and the shaft on the clutch device 7 can be selected according to nursing requirements, so that the nursing machine is more diversified and different requirements are met.
In addition, the back lifting mechanism 2 and the leg bending and foot lifting mechanism 4 which are arranged on the upper part of the bedstead 1 can be used for completing the body position adjustment and the leg body position action of the back of a patient through adjustment, and can be combined with the bedstead 1 which is adjusted through the clutch device 7, so that the back lifting mechanism 2 or the leg bending and foot lifting mechanism 4 can be adjusted at different heights of the bedstead 1; in addition, after the whole bedstead 1 is inclined, the back lifting mechanism 2 or the leg bending and foot lifting mechanism 4 on the bedstead can be adjusted to complete the adjustment of the body position in a larger range.
Preferably, the lifting mechanism comprises a third bracket 5, a fourth bracket 12 and a first connecting rod 11, wherein the third bracket 5 is vertically arranged at the bottom of the bedstead 1, the fourth bracket 12 is vertically arranged at the upper part of the lower frame, one end of the first connecting rod 11 is hinged with the third bracket 5, and the other end of the first connecting rod 11 is hinged with the fourth bracket 12.
As shown in fig. 4 and 5, in one embodiment, the clutch 7 includes a housing 18, an input shaft 24 installed in the housing 18, a driving gear 23 installed on the input shaft 24, an output shaft 17, a driven gear 16 installed on the output shaft 17, a transmission shaft 19, and a transmission gear 26 installed on the transmission shaft 19, the transmission shaft 19 is installed between the input shaft 24 and the output shaft 17, the transmission gear 26 is used for connecting the driving gear 23 and the driven gear 16, the transmission gear 26 is detachably meshed with the driving gear 23 and the driven gear 16, the transmission shaft 19 is a stepped shaft, the small diameter of the transmission shaft 19 is sequentially sleeved with the transmission gear 26 and a spring 25, a gear mechanism is arranged on the large diameter of the transmission shaft 19, the gear mechanism includes a stand column 20, a handle 21 and an axial groove 27 and a clamping groove 28 arranged on the housing 18, the stand column 20 is fixed on the transmission shaft 19, the handle 21 is connected with the large diameter end of the transmission shaft 19, the axial groove 27 and the clamping groove 28 is located right above the transmission shaft 19 and is perpendicular to each other, the stand column 20 is matched with the axial groove 27 and the clamping groove 28, the axial groove 27 is matched with the axial groove 26 and the driven gear 16 or the driven gear 16, and the driven gear 16 is further meshed with the drive shaft 16 or the driven gear 25, and the drive shaft is further meshed with the drive gear is controlled to move by the axial groove and the drive gear 26.
In addition, the mounting mode of the clutch device 7 is also divided into horizontal mounting and vertical mounting according to the mounting space position, and when the vertical mounting is adopted, the length of the first bracket 9 is not equal to the length of the second bracket 14 because the height difference exists between the input shaft 24 and the output shaft 17 on the clutch device; the clutch device 7 is horizontally arranged, the input shaft 24 and the output shaft 17 on the clutch device 7 are positioned on the same horizontal plane, and the first bracket length 9 is equal to the second bracket length 14.
